package odoo
import (
"fmt"
)
// AccountAnalyticLine represents account.analytic.line model.
type AccountAnalyticLine struct {
LastUpdate *Time `xmlrpc:"__last_update,omptempty"`
AccountId *Many2One `xmlrpc:"account_id,omptempty"`
Amount *Float `xmlrpc:"amount,omptempty"`
AmountCurrency *Float `xmlrpc:"amount_currency,omptempty"`
AnalyticAmountCurrency *Float `xmlrpc:"analytic_amount_currency,omptempty"`
Code *String `xmlrpc:"code,omptempty"`
CompanyCurrencyId *Many2One `xmlrpc:"company_currency_id,omptempty"`
CompanyId *Many2One `xmlrpc:"company_id,omptempty"`
CreateDate *Time `xmlrpc:"create_date,omptempty"`
CreateUid *Many2One `xmlrpc:"create_uid,omptempty"`
CurrencyId *Many2One `xmlrpc:"currency_id,omptempty"`
Date *Time `xmlrpc:"date,omptempty"`
DepartmentId *Many2One `xmlrpc:"department_id,omptempty"`
DisplayName *String `xmlrpc:"display_name,omptempty"`
EmployeeId *Many2One `xmlrpc:"employee_id,omptempty"`
GeneralAccountId *Many2One `xmlrpc:"general_account_id,omptempty"`
HolidayId *Many2One `xmlrpc:"holiday_id,omptempty"`
Id *Int `xmlrpc:"id,omptempty"`
MoveId *Many2One `xmlrpc:"move_id,omptempty"`
Name *String `xmlrpc:"name,omptempty"`
PartnerId *Many2One `xmlrpc:"partner_id,omptempty"`
ProductId *Many2One `xmlrpc:"product_id,omptempty"`
ProductUomId *Many2One `xmlrpc:"product_uom_id,omptempty"`
ProjectId *Many2One `xmlrpc:"project_id,omptempty"`
Ref *String `xmlrpc:"ref,omptempty"`
SoLine *Many2One `xmlrpc:"so_line,omptempty"`
TagIds *Relation `xmlrpc:"tag_ids,omptempty"`
TaskId *Many2One `xmlrpc:"task_id,omptempty"`
TimesheetInvoiceId *Many2One `xmlrpc:"timesheet_invoice_id,omptempty"`
TimesheetInvoiceType *Selection `xmlrpc:"timesheet_invoice_type,omptempty"`
TimesheetRevenue *Float `xmlrpc:"timesheet_revenue,omptempty"`
UnitAmount *Float `xmlrpc:"unit_amount,omptempty"`
UserId *Many2One `xmlrpc:"user_id,omptempty"`
WriteDate *Time `xmlrpc:"write_date,omptempty"`
WriteUid *Many2One `xmlrpc:"write_uid,omptempty"`
}
// AccountAnalyticLines represents array of account.analytic.line model.
type AccountAnalyticLines []AccountAnalyticLine
// AccountAnalyticLineModel is the odoo model name.
const AccountAnalyticLineModel = "account.analytic.line"
// Many2One convert AccountAnalyticLine to *Many2One.
func (aal *AccountAnalyticLine) Many2One() *Many2One {
return NewMany2One(aal.Id.Get(), "")
}
// CreateAccountAnalyticLine creates a new account.analytic.line model and returns its id.
func (c *Client) CreateAccountAnalyticLine(aal *AccountAnalyticLine) (int64, error) {
return c.Create(AccountAnalyticLineModel, aal)
}
// UpdateAccountAnalyticLine updates an existing account.analytic.line record.
func (c *Client) UpdateAccountAnalyticLine(aal *AccountAnalyticLine) error {
return c.UpdateAccountAnalyticLines([]int64{aal.Id.Get()}, aal)
}
// UpdateAccountAnalyticLines updates existing account.analytic.line records.
// All records (represented by ids) will be updated by aal values.
func (c *Client) UpdateAccountAnalyticLines(ids []int64, aal *AccountAnalyticLine) error {
return c.Update(AccountAnalyticLineModel, ids, aal)
}
// DeleteAccountAnalyticLine deletes an existing account.analytic.line record.
func (c *Client) DeleteAccountAnalyticLine(id int64) error {
return c.DeleteAccountAnalyticLines([]int64{id})
}
// DeleteAccountAnalyticLines deletes existing account.analytic.line records.
func (c *Client) DeleteAccountAnalyticLines(ids []int64) error {
return c.Delete(AccountAnalyticLineModel, ids)
}
// GetAccountAnalyticLine gets account.analytic.line existing record.
func (c *Client) GetAccountAnalyticLine(id int64) (*AccountAnalyticLine, error) {
aals, err := c.GetAccountAnalyticLines([]int64{id})
if err != nil {
return nil, err
}
if aals != nil && len(*aals) > 0 {
return &((*aals)[0]), nil
}
return nil, fmt.Errorf("id %v of account.analytic.line not found", id)
}
// GetAccountAnalyticLines gets account.analytic.line existing records.
func (c *Client) GetAccountAnalyticLines(ids []int64) (*AccountAnalyticLines, error) {
aals := &AccountAnalyticLines{}
if err := c.Read(AccountAnalyticLineModel, ids, nil, aals); err != nil {
return nil, err
}
return aals, nil
}
// FindAccountAnalyticLine finds account.analytic.line record by querying it with criteria.
func (c *Client) FindAccountAnalyticLine(criteria *Criteria) (*AccountAnalyticLine, error) {
aals := &AccountAnalyticLines{}
if err := c.SearchRead(AccountAnalyticLineModel, criteria, NewOptions().Limit(1), aals); err != nil {
return nil, err
}
if aals != nil && len(*aals) > 0 {
return &((*aals)[0]), nil
}
return nil, fmt.Errorf("no account.analytic.line was found with criteria %v", criteria)
}
// FindAccountAnalyticLines finds account.analytic.line records by querying it
// and filtering it with criteria and options.
func (c *Client) FindAccountAnalyticLines(criteria *Criteria, options *Options) (*AccountAnalyticLines, error) {
aals := &AccountAnalyticLines{}
if err := c.SearchRead(AccountAnalyticLineModel, criteria, options, aals); err != nil {
return nil, err
}
return aals, nil
}
// FindAccountAnalyticLineIds finds records ids by querying it
// and filtering it with criteria and options.
func (c *Client) FindAccountAnalyticLineIds(criteria *Criteria, options *Options) ([]int64, error) {
ids, err := c.Search(AccountAnalyticLineModel, criteria, options)
if err != nil {
return []int64{}, err
}
return ids, nil
}
// FindAccountAnalyticLineId finds record id by querying it with criteria.
func (c *Client) FindAccountAnalyticLineId(criteria *Criteria, options *Options) (int64, error) {
ids, err := c.Search(AccountAnalyticLineModel, criteria, options)
if err != nil {
return -1, err
}
if len(ids) > 0 {
return ids[0], nil
}
return -1, fmt.Errorf("no account.analytic.line was found with criteria %v and options %v", criteria, options)
}
